Barry Williams is an Associate Professor of Banking, Department of Banking and Finance. Barry has taught in the areas of financial markets and Institutions and international finance. His research focuses upon the banking industry, in particular the areas of bank performance and risk, both domestically and multinationally.

Previously Barry worked at Bond University where he was a Professor of Finance and also a founding Co-Director of the Globalisation and Development Center at the Faculty of Business. Barry also is a visiting researcher at the Australian Prudential Regulation Authority (APRA) and the Swiss Economic Institute (KOF), Swiss Federal Institute of Technology (ETH), Zurich. Before commencing an academic career, Barry worked in the economics department of the State Bank of Victoria.

Barry’s research has been published in the Journal of Banking and Finance, the Australian Journal of Management, the Journal of International Financial Markets, Institutions and Instruments, Financial Markets, Institutions and Instruments, the Journal of Economic Surveys and Applied Economics.
